[WebGL][Windows] Realtime lights look different than in editor
To reproduce:
1. Build and run attached project
2. Notice only the closest light seems to be visible. It has hard edges and no falloff
Expected:
Lights in WebGL should look like they do in the editor.
Reproducible: 5.4.0b12, 5.3.4p1, 5.2.4p1, 5.1.4f1, 5.0.4f1
